Output 84f668c8a597f8f0c126807403d20a7814bbab32bf156bd1880ee8c1d13dc711:0

value
39000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27f5d9078d07a2c410db51d502c77a9c3f09d14b OP_EQUALVERIFY OP_CHECKSIG
address
14eHsHURACkpWxJu62y5ViYDK4ndjbQt52
transaction
84f668c8a597f8f0c126807403d20a7814bbab32bf156bd1880ee8c1d13dc711
spent
true